Stéphane BEZIEAU  PharmD, PhD, Professor of Human Genetics, CHU Nantes

S. Bézieau is Head of medical genetics department at CHU of Nantes. After his pharmaceutical studies (PharmD, 1996), he became interested in biology, specializing in molecular genetics
(PhD in Molecular Genetics, 2000). He continued his research in the field of oncogenetics between 2000 and 2010 and participated in the GECCO (Genetics and Epidemiology of Colorectal Cancer) consortium. Since 2013, he has focused on the discovery of new genes involved in intellectual disabilities (PHRC HUGODIMS); this topic has been investigated through major international collaborations with renowned partners such as the Baylor College of Medicine and Duke University. In February 2018, he was elected President of the French Federation of Human Genetics. He is also an elected member of the Board of Directors of the French Foundation for Rare Diseases.
